Overview
We're teaming up with World Labs, Tripo, mint.gg, and Convex.dev for a one-day hackathon in San Francisco at the intersection of spatial intelligence and generative 3D.
Participants will get hands-on access to some of the best tools for generating 3D content and turning it into functional, interactive experiences:
-
World Labs, large world models for generating immersive worlds
-
Tripo, rapid 3D asset generation for creating game-ready objects
-
mint.gg, agentic creation platform and developer tools for bringing worlds and assets together as interactive, playable experiences
-
Convex.dev, real-time backend infrastructure for powering application data, state, multiplayer systems, and agentic experiences
Together, we'll explore what becomes possible when entire worlds, detailed 3D objects, and real-time scenes can be generated from little more than a prompt or an image, and then quickly assembled, programmed, connected, and shared.
Tracks
-
Gaming & Interactive Worlds, Playable worlds, games, multiplayer experiences, interactive applications, and real-time 3D scenes
-
Physical AI & Simulation, Robotics, simulation, embodied agents, spatial reasoning, training environments, and digital twins
-
Creative 3D & VFX, Visual effects, virtual production, cinematic experiences, creative tools, real-time graphics, and experimental projects that do not fit neatly into the other tracks
